Car keys have come a long way considering that the early days of automotive car locksmith near me history. At first, car keys were easy mechanical devices. Nevertheless, with the introduction of technology, they have become more advanced and protected. Today, there are several kinds of car keys, each needing specialized understanding and tools:
Traditional Metal Keys: These are the easiest and most standard type of car keys. They are utilized to lock and open the car's doors and spark the engine. A locksmith can easily duplicate these keys utilizing a key-cutting machine.
Transponder Keys: These keys include a microchip that communicates with the car's immobilizer system to allow the engine to begin. Replicating and programming a transponder key is more complex and requires specific equipment.
Remote Head Keys: These keys have a remote control integrated into the key head, permitting the motorist to lock and unlock the car from a range. A locksmith can program the remote functions of these keys.
Keyless Entry and Start Systems: Modern lorries often include keyless entry and start systems, which utilize a fob or a smart device app to unlock and start the car. Locksmiths can aid with the programming and troubleshooting of these systems.
Smart Keys: These keys are highly advanced and can carry out several functions, such as starting the car, locking and opening doors, and adjusting seat positions. Locksmith professionals need to be skilled in the latest innovations to work with wise keys.

Q: How long does it take to replicate a car key?
A: Duplicating a conventional metal key can take simply a couple of minutes. Nevertheless, programming a transponder or wise key can use up to an hour, depending upon the intricacy of the key and the locksmith's equipment.
Q: Can a locksmith program a key for a car mobile locksmith near me with a keyless entry system?
A: Yes, locksmiths can program keys for cars with keyless entry systems. They utilize specialized programming tools and often require to access the car's on-board computer system to finish the task.

Q: How much does it cost to get a car key programmed by a locksmith?
A: The cost of programming a car key can differ depending upon the kind of key and the make and design of the vehicle. Normally, it can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200 or more.
Q: Can I program a car key myself?
A: Some vehicles enable DIY key programming, however this is typically a complicated procedure that can lead to mistakes. It is typically suggested to seek the assistance of a professional locksmith to make sure that the key is programmed correctly.
